#aa2f54 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#aa2f54 is composed of 66.7% red, 18.4%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.4% magenta, 50.6% yellow and 33.3% black. It has a hue angle of 342 degrees, a saturation of 56.7% and a lightness of 42.5%. #aa2f54 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5ea8 with #550000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

Shades and Tints of #aa2f54

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fbf1f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#aa2f54

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#70696b is the less saturated color, while #d40543 is the most saturated one.
